Jogging around Walpole offers access to an extensive network of trails, numerous parks, and preserved natural spaces. The region is characterized by undulating fields, dense woodlands, streams, and several ponds, providing diverse and scenic routes. Walpole's landscape includes varied terrains, from high wooded slopes to boardwalks over wetlands, making it suitable for different running preferences. The town's commitment to conservation ensures well-maintained public areas for outdoor activities.

Adams Farm Barn and Pavilion is a place to host group and family gatherings, as well as fundraisers. It also serves as a great starting point for your run in the preserve, with an extensive network of well-marked trails. The total distance of the trails in the network is estimated to be around 10 miles, and plenty of parking is available.

Moose Hill is a peak within the Moose Hill Wildlife Sanctuary in Massachusetts. At the summit, there's a fire tower and scenic overlook offering breathtaking panoramic views of the surrounding area, including vistas over Boston. The scenery is particularly stunning during the fall months, when the foliage transforms into vibrant shades of orange and red.

This very pleasant section of road leads you to Moose Hill Farm. Moose Hill is a very old wildlife reserve created in 1916. This place is also home to the Nature Cooperative School, where students explore the surrounding pastures, meadows, woods, and wetlands on a daily basis.

Frequently Asked Questions

How many running routes are available in Walpole?

Walpole offers a wide selection of running routes, with over 40 trails documented on komoot. These routes cater to various preferences, ranging from easy loops to more challenging moderate trails.

Are there easy jogging routes suitable for beginners or families in Walpole?

Yes, Walpole has several easy jogging routes perfect for beginners or families. An excellent option is the Moose Hill, Bay Circuit, Turkey, Bluff & Billings loop — Moose Hill Wildlife Sanctuary, which is 3 miles long and explores fields, forests, and wetlands in a serene setting. Francis William Bird Park also offers three miles of trails ideal for light recreation.

Where can I find scenic views or natural landmarks while jogging in Walpole?

Walpole's jogging routes offer numerous scenic views and natural landmarks. The Old Farm, Woodland, Pepperbrush, Warner & Bay Circuit Trail loop — Moose Hill Farm provides varied terrain with woodlands and open fields. For stunning vistas, the Bluff Trail within Moose Hill Wildlife Sanctuary is highly recommended. You can also explore the Walpole Town Forest for views of a dam and a rushing waterfall, or enjoy the tranquil Neponset River from White's Bridge.

Are there any trails that are part of a larger network?

Yes, Walpole's extensive trail system integrates with sections of the 230-mile Bay Circuit Trail. This allows joggers to explore much of Walpole on foot and connect to a broader network of trails, offering opportunities for longer runs and varied landscapes. Routes like the Old Farm, Woodland, Pepperbrush, Warner & Bay Circuit Trail loop — Moose Hill Farm incorporate parts of this larger trail system.

Can I find trails with water features like ponds or rivers?

Absolutely. Walpole's natural beauty is enhanced by several scenic ponds and the tranquil Neponset River. Willett Pond in North Walpole is known for its dramatic sunrises and sunsets, while Memorial Pond in downtown Walpole features a viewing dock. The Neponset River provides a serene backdrop, with a particularly scenic stretch accessible from White's Bridge in the Walpole Town Forest.
